Zoomarine launches holiday camps for Easter

There are two programs to choose from during the holidays

The Zoomarine theme park has just announced the launch of holiday camps for Easter, with two proposals for children between 6 and 13 years old.

«Does the Easter Bunny Lay Eggs? And the sharks? And the butterflies?” asks Zoomarine. «If you want to provide your children with unique moments of fun these Easter holidays and you don't know what to do, you don't need to despair anymore», the park has proposals.

One of the programs is called "The Secret Life at the Zoo», during which children aged between 8 and 12 can spend a night in the park, with a program full of fun activities and unique and memorable experiences.

In this program the great protagonists will be the Oceanus sharks! It takes place on the night of April 6th to 7th and has a maximum capacity of 12 children.

The other program is d'«The Guardians of Zoomarine», where children aged between 6 and 13 explore the park in a unique way, meeting some of Zoomarine's great ambassadors and learning some behaviors that can help protect Nature.

This program takes place in the week following Easter, between April 10th and 14th, with a maximum capacity of 12 participants.

Registration opens on the 12th of February and takes place differently, depending on the programme:
– Guardians of Zoomarine: reservations through Zoomarine official website;
– Secret Life at the Zoo: reservations via email [email protected] .
